It may be helpful:Here are some things to look for from an Insurance prospective:1.Any in-ground tanks (active or inactive)2.Any Knob & Tube or Aluminum Wiring3.If built before 1978, does the building have Lead Safe certifications4.Any wood stoves or secondary heating units.

There is also the issue of it being more difficult to install as the shingle is more brittle, and its much easier for the nails to blow through the shingle during install.Temperature isn't the end-all if your roof is completely shot - shingles can be held in a heated tent until they are ready to be installed, handled more carefully, and hand-sealed.
